ich habe mich gefragt, ob es möglich ist, eine Einstellung zu ändern oder ein Plugin für Discourse hinzuzufügen, das Folgendes ermöglicht:
Einen Button „Neues Thema“ für alle sichtbar machen (registrierte und nicht registrierte Benutzer)
Ein Popup zum Erstellen eines neuen Themas für alle anzeigen
Die Aufforderung zur Registrierung und das Formular nach dem Verfassen eines neuen Themas oder zumindest nach dem Klick auf den Button „Neues Thema“ anzeigen.
Das wirkt wie eine einfache Möglichkeit, nicht registrierte Personen zur Registrierung und zum Posten zu ermutigen. Ohne diese Funktion gibt es keinen offensichtlichen Hinweis, sich an der Diskussion zu beteiligen.
Wird der Benutzer bereits informiert, dass er sich registrieren muss, bevor er eine Nachricht sendet, also bevor er Zeit damit verbringt, die Nachricht zu verfassen?
Ich erinnere mich an einige Websites, die es mir erlaubten, ein Textfeld auszufüllen, ohne mir mitzuteilen, dass ich mich später registrieren müsste, damit meine Nachricht veröffentlicht wird. Das hat mich sehr genervt, und ich habe die Seite verlassen.
Wenn Sie bereit sind, einige Entwicklungsarbeiten zu leisten, können Sie sicherlich etwas sehr Ähnliches tun, wenn nicht sogar genau das, was Sie beschreiben.
Der Button könnte dauerhaft vorhanden sein.
Sie würden den Benutzer jedoch einfach zur Anmeldeseite weiterleiten, wenn er nicht eingeloggt ist, oder den Editor öffnen, wenn er eingeloggt ist.
Entwürfe sind an Benutzer gebunden, daher halte ich es für keineswegs einfach, das bestehende Verhalten so zu ändern, dass anonyme Benutzer Entwürfe erstellen können.
Leider kenne ich kein bestehendes Open-Source-Plugin oder TC, das dies ermöglicht.